Graphics Driver – Definition & Detailed Explanation – Computer Graphics Glossary Terms

I. What is a Graphics Driver?

A graphics driver, also known as a video driver, is a software program that allows a computer’s operating system to communicate with the graphics hardware installed on the system. The graphics driver acts as a translator between the operating system and the graphics hardware, enabling the system to display images, videos, and other visual content on the screen. Without a graphics driver, the computer would not be able to properly render graphics and would not be able to display any visual content.

II. How Does a Graphics Driver Work?

A graphics driver works by providing the necessary instructions and commands to the graphics hardware in order to render images and videos on the screen. When a user interacts with the computer, the operating system sends commands to the graphics driver, which then communicates with the graphics hardware to carry out the requested actions. The graphics driver is responsible for tasks such as rendering 2D and 3D graphics, processing video playback, and managing display settings.

III. Why are Graphics Drivers Important?

Graphics drivers are essential for ensuring that a computer’s graphics hardware functions properly and efficiently. Without up-to-date graphics drivers, the computer may experience performance issues, display glitches, and compatibility problems with software applications. Graphics drivers also play a crucial role in optimizing the performance of graphics-intensive tasks such as gaming, video editing, and graphic design. By keeping graphics drivers updated, users can ensure that their computer’s graphics hardware is running at its best.

IV. What are the Common Graphics Driver Issues?

There are several common issues that can arise with graphics drivers, including:

1. Display glitches: Graphics drivers that are outdated or incompatible with the operating system may cause display glitches such as screen flickering, artifacts, or distorted images.

2. Performance issues: Outdated graphics drivers can lead to poor performance in graphics-intensive applications, resulting in slow rendering times, low frame rates, and laggy gameplay.

3. Compatibility problems: Graphics drivers that are not compatible with certain software applications may cause crashes, errors, or other issues when running those applications.

4. Driver conflicts: Installing multiple graphics drivers or using outdated drivers can lead to conflicts between different drivers, resulting in system instability or crashes.

V. How to Update Graphics Drivers?

Updating graphics drivers is a simple process that can be done manually or automatically. To update graphics drivers manually, users can visit the website of the graphics card manufacturer (such as NVIDIA, AMD, or Intel) and download the latest driver software for their specific graphics hardware model. The user can then install the driver software by following the on-screen instructions.

Alternatively, users can use driver update software tools that automatically scan the system for outdated drivers and download the latest versions from the manufacturer’s website. These tools can simplify the process of updating drivers and ensure that the system is always running with the most up-to-date drivers.

VI. What are the Best Practices for Managing Graphics Drivers?

To ensure optimal performance and stability, it is important to follow best practices for managing graphics drivers, including:

1. Regularly check for driver updates: Keep graphics drivers up to date by checking for updates on a regular basis and installing the latest versions to ensure compatibility and performance improvements.

2. Create system backups: Before updating graphics drivers, create a system backup to protect against any potential issues that may arise during the update process.

3. Uninstall old drivers: Before installing new graphics drivers, uninstall any old or outdated drivers to prevent conflicts and ensure a clean installation.

4. Use driver update software: Consider using driver update software tools to automate the process of checking for and installing driver updates, saving time and effort.

By following these best practices, users can ensure that their graphics drivers are properly managed and optimized for peak performance on their computer systems.